+Battery charger driver for MAX77650 PMIC from Maxim Integrated.
+
+This module is part of the MAX77650 MFD device. For more details
+see Documentation/devicetree/bindings/mfd/max77650.txt.
+
+The charger is represented as a sub-node of the PMIC node on the device tree.
+
+Required properties:
+--------------------
+- compatible:		Must be "maxim,max77650-charger"
+
+Optional properties:
+--------------------
+- min-microvolt:	Minimum CHGIN regulation voltage (in microvolts). Must be
+			one of: 4000000, 4100000, 4200000, 4300000, 4400000,
+			4500000, 4600000, 4700000.
+- curr-lim-microamp:	CHGIN input current limit (in microamps). Must be one of:
+			95000, 190000, 285000, 380000, 475000.
+
+Example:
+--------
+
+	charger {
+		compatible = "maxim,max77650-charger";
+		min-microvolt = <4200000>;
+		curr-lim-microamp = <285000>;
+	};
